    Hey Riders,

    I have a 2010 RT that is fun to ride but not so fun to repair sometimes. It's now showing that the VSS module part number 219800097 needs to be replaced, looks like it's the same part through 2012.
    anybody out there know of someone parting out an RT or a good salvage yard that handles Spyders?

    Unless you are ABSOLUTELY SURE ( by testing it with a device, not a Spyder code ) ./... I would take key from ignition dis-connect BOTH leads to the Battery and touch them together .... wait about 5-10 minutes and then reconnect ( using Star washers on terminals ) ..... this will allow a complete RE_BOOT of the computers ..... then start it & see if the CODE dis-appears .....good luck ....Mike
